Output 84c324d0aea561014df084fb57c89e708937713e5f6369413729fb2224699894:3

value
1273565277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f6dd4e3a30986b375aedb720d718377377afaee OP_EQUAL
address
MGbjztRD8uFLmX9jUbPfV158i4zzH9D9Eb
transaction
84c324d0aea561014df084fb57c89e708937713e5f6369413729fb2224699894
spent
true